我正在尝试使用buildroot为基于imx6的系统构建RFS,并且我想将qt webkit添加到我的系统中,以便我的软件写入Qt5并使用webenginewidgets将运行。但是,当我在qt5下的buildroot中启用qt5webkit时,buildroot会给我以下错误。Buildroot - 启用Qt5 WebKit
/home/mkp/buildroot-2016.11/output/build/qt5webkit-b35917bcb44d7f200af0f4ac68a126fa0aa8d93d/Source/WebCore//libWebCore.a: member /home/mkp/buildroot-2016.11/output/build/qt5webkit-b35917bcb44d7f200af0f4ac68a126fa0aa8d93d/Source/WebCore//.obj/svg/SVGAllInOne.o in archive is not an object
collect2: error: ld returned 1 exit status
make[3]: *** [../lib/libQt5WebKit.so.5.6.2] Error 1
make[3]: Leaving directory `/home/mkp/buildroot-2016.11/output/build/qt5webkit-b35917bcb44d7f200af0f4ac68a126fa0aa8d93d/Source'
make[2]: *** [sub-api-pri-make_first-ordered] Error 2
make[2]: Leaving directory `/home/mkp/buildroot-2016.11/output/build/qt5webkit-b35917bcb44d7f200af0f4ac68a126fa0aa8d93d/Source'
make[1]: *** [sub-Source-QtWebKit-pro-make_first-ordered] Error 2
make[1]: Leaving directory `/home/mkp/buildroot-2016.11/output/build/qt5webkit-b35917bcb44d7f200af0f4ac68a126fa0aa8d93d'
make: *** [/home/mkp/buildroot-2016.11/output/build/qt5webkit-b35917bcb44d7f200af0f4ac68a126fa0aa8d93d/.stamp_built] Error 2
蹊跷约SVGAllInOne.cpp或的.o但是,我无法弄清楚。 顺便说一句,buildroot是最新的。
你运行的是哪个版本的Qt? – demonplus
正如我从buildroot下载的软件包中看到的,它似乎是qt 5.6.2 – mkpeker